For anyone looking to develop an online Raspberry Pi circuit diagram maker, the task can seem daunting. With a diverse range of components, software and coding knowledge all required, it is easy to see why many would be put off attempting such a project.
However, with the right guidance, it is possible to create a fully functioning, accessible circuit diagram maker that can be used by schools, hobbyists and professionals alike.
When it comes to creating a circuit diagram maker for Raspberry Pi, the first thing to consider is the range of components that are needed. Components such as resistors and capacitors, relays, transistors, integrated circuits and more all play an important role in powering and controlling a circuit board.
The next step is to decide on the software you will use to power your circuit diagram maker. There are a number of options available, from simple drag-and-drop circuit diagrams to more complex visual programming languages. Depending on the complexity of the project and the level of experience of the user, the choice of which software to use can vary.
Once the software has been selected, the user should then determine the best way to present the circuit diagram. This could be either through a GUI or web interface, or even a physical device that can be plugged into a computer. Whichever method is chosen, it is essential that the user is able to easily identify individual components, follow the flow of signals and trace the circuitry.
The user should also consider the various safety measures they need to take when working with circuit diagrams. Many components used in Raspberry Pi projects are highly sensitive and require extreme care when being handled. It is important to ensure that all components are correctly wired and that the circuit diagram is designed in such a way that it can be safely used.
Finally, the user needs to think about how the circuit diagram maker will be used in the future. Will it be made available as a service, or will the user have to purchase the software to use it? If the user is planning to share their work with others, they may want to consider making the software open source so that anyone can access and modify it.
Creating an online circuit diagram maker for Raspberry Pi requires a lot of time and effort, but with the right guidance, it is possible to create a fully functioning, accessible circuit diagram maker that can be used for both educational and professional purposes. By researching the components needed, selecting the right software, designing an intuitive user interface and ensuring safety measures are in place, users can design and share their own circuit diagrams with ease.
